Output e62fefca9a3aec19752ef104f2ac7f7c812f6a75de89adb5fdca6c5a6b64dfc3:1

value
8949917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a631a6cfecf9d9c59c0ced564afdf3b6940d65e OP_EQUAL
address
3EJjtq3dgJc5yyUgdNWnYGkb8L3QNAtSNa
transaction
e62fefca9a3aec19752ef104f2ac7f7c812f6a75de89adb5fdca6c5a6b64dfc3
confirmations
373600
spent
true